About Bhubaneswar (BBI)

Serving as the capital of the Indian state of Odisha, Bhubaneswar is a heritage destination that is renowned for its ancient temples and classical architecture. The Old Town of this city presents a collection of nearly 400 Hindu temples, making it a must-visit part of the city on any trip to Bhubaneswar. Built in the 11th Century, Lingaraj Temple is one of the major attractions of this city. The presence of Bindu Sarovara- a huge water body greatly enhances the beauty of the city. Another important place of tourist interest is Dhauli Giri- a picturesque hill, located around eight km away from the city. This site is popular as the place where Emperor Ashoka renounced violence after waging the Kalinga War and embraced Buddhism. Nandankanan Zoo presents a rare biodiversity for the visitors to explore. The Museum of Tribal Art & Artefacts is an interesting place to visit on a Bhubaneswar tour. Other popular places that can keep tourists engaged in sightseeing for days are Khandagiri and Udayagiri, Mukteshwara Temple, Rajarani Temple, Odisha State Museum and Deras Dam. About Cyprus (CY)

The legendary birthplace of Aphrodite, Cyprus is every inch the Mediterranean- a tapestry of sublime beaches, ancient wonders, dramatic landscapes, terracotta pottery and the obligatory party resorts! Nissi & Makronissos are the perfect white sand beaches with clear waters and popular partying spot in Ayia Napa. Head to Episkopi for kite surfing, scuba diving and windsurf boarding. Or the family friendly Protaras, famous for outdoor seafood restaurants, beaches and views. Rent a boat to spot lagoons at Blue Lagoon in Akamas. Hire a car for day trips to Paphos (stunning coastlines), hike to the Troodos Mountains (picturesque villages with local attractions). Explore the Caledonia Falls in Platres, swim in the green water at Adonis Baths near Paphos. Hop on a jeep safari, pass through beautiful vineyards, forests and mountain villages. Wander the outdoor market of Omodos, one of the oldest monasteries in Cyprus. While strolling the cities, you can spot the preserved ancient burial site of The Tombs of the Kings, World Heritage Site Kato Paphos Archaeological Park, to the medieval ruins of Saint Hilarion Castle. Or the charming cobblestone street villages of Pano Lefkara, Lofou and Kato-Drys, where ladies practice traditional skills like weaving and lacework. Tantalize your taste buds with the local cuisine heavily influenced by Turkish, Greek and Middle Eastern food cultures; Hummus, Kebabs, Afelia (pork cooked in red wine), Sheftalia (Cypriot sausages), Souvlaki (chicken, pork or lamb skewers) and sweet treats like Rice Puddings and Baklava.
